Archaeology Henricus. April 14-18. Ages 8-12. Henricus Foundation Patrons (Alexander Whittaker Level and above). New this year for Spring Break!  Join a week-long archaeological project at Henricus Historical Park.  Learn about the tools and strategies used to help locate sites and the archaeological method to understand how to create a living history museum.  Help sort, catalogue and clean artifacts found in the area and help us locate the 1611 fort!  Field trip included.  Registration required by April 9th by calling 804-318-8797.

Mad Science Spring Break Camp. April 14-18, 2014. Keep the kids busy over Spring Break!  Our Spring Science Sampler camp is a mix of themes taken from the upcoming 2014 summer camp season.  Each day will be a different theme.  The kids will stay busy in the morning exploring topics such as chemistry, space, robotics & spy academy!  After lunch, we will take a break for movie and then back to more science.  Camps will go from 9 AM to 4 PM and run $250.  There is a $20 discount for siblings.  These camps are for grades 1 to 5.  Before and after care is available too from 8:30 AM to 5:30 PM.

kidzRICHMOND, VA (January 8, 2014) – Style Weekly will host its 15th annual camp and summer programs resource event, Kidz Connection & Camp Fair at the Science Museum of Virginia on February 1, 2014 from 12 noon to 3 p.m.

This event connects Richmond families with the resources they need to make informative decisions about kids’ activities and services; from camps and summer programs, doctors and family photographers, to entertainment for birthday parties and special events.

  • Camp Fair – helping parents make decisions on summer time options for their children. Regional camps and summer programs are represented from arts, sports, day and overnight camps.
